The 1st District Court of Appeal last week ruled that a corporate officer for an elevator service company could not be haled into Florida to defend against claims of misconduct by the family of a fatally injured worker.
Robert Myers had worked for the Otis Elevator Co. In February 2017, he went to Tallahassee Memorial HealthCare to perform maintenance work on an elevator.
Myers pushed the emergency stop button, which is supposed to make the elevator inoperable. Security cameras captured footage of Myers entering the elevator shaft, and the movement of his flashlight beam as he worked.
